Jupiter, Fla. is one of my favorite places in the state mostly because of the Blowing Rocks Preserve. It’s got nothing on the jagged coastline of California, but it’s gorgeous in its own right with interesting rock formations and deep turquoise water. Now, I’ll be the first to admit that I was entirely overdressed for this outing. (There’s not a lot of flexibility for midday clothing changes when you’re on vacation and away from the hotel!) That didn’t stop us from kicking off our shoes to stroll along the ocean’s edge until we were ready for lunch at Little Moir’s Food Shack. The small restaurant–with the best seafood ever–is tucked away in an unassuming strip mall. Be sure to order the signature sweet potato-crusted fish. They also have an impressive beer lineup.

I’m challenging myself to get through a backlog I’m challenging myself to get through a backlog of travel photos before we book our next trip. First up, photos of the gothic York Minster. I’m not religious in the slightest but I can’t resist stunning architecture and the opportunity to climb hundreds of cathedral stairs for a city view. This one only had a single rest stop about halfway up the flight of 275 steps for a closeup view of the flying buttresses — and a waiver you had to sign before your ascent to promise you’re healthy enough to make it.
